117.info
人生若只如初见

在MySQL中如何设计Log4net的日志表结构

在MySQL中设计Log4net的日志表结构,可以按照以下步骤进行:

  1. 创建一个数据库用于存储Log4net的日志信息,例如创建一个名为log_db的数据库。
CREATE DATABASE log_db;
  1. log_db数据库中创建一个表用于存储Log4net的日志信息,例如创建一个名为log_table的表。
CREATE TABLE log_table (
    id INT AUTO_INCREMENT PRIMARY KEY,
    date_time DATETIME,
    logger VARCHAR(255),
    level VARCHAR(50),
    message TEXT
);
  1. log_table表中定义相应的字段用于存储Log4net的日志信息,例如date_time用于存储日志记录时间,logger用于存储日志记录器名称,level用于存储日志级别,message用于存储日志消息内容。可以根据实际需求添加其他字段。

  2. 针对不同的日志级别,可以在level字段上创建索引来提高查询性能。

  3. 如果需要对日志信息进行分析和统计,可以根据实际需求在log_table表中添加其他字段用于存储额外的信息,例如请求来源、用户信息等。

通过以上步骤,在MySQL中设计Log4net的日志表结构,可以有效地存储和管理Log4net的日志信息,并支持日志分析和统计等功能。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e0b9AzsBCQNWBQ.html

推荐文章

  • docker怎么查看mysql版本

    要查看Docker容器中安装的MySQL版本,可以在终端中执行以下命令: 首先,使用docker ps命令查看当前正在运行的Docker容器的ID: docker ps 找到正在运行的MySQL容...

  • mysql彻底删除卸载的方法是什么

    要彻底删除和卸载MySQL数据库,需要执行以下步骤: 停止MySQL服务:使用适当的命令停止MySQL数据库服务。例如,在Linux系统中可以使用以下命令: sudo service m...

  • mysql两个字段排序方法是什么

    在MySQL中,可以使用ORDER BY子句对多个字段进行排序。可以按照多个字段来排序,语法如下:
    SELECT * FROM table_name
    ORDER BY field1, field2; 其中...

  • MySQL算法有哪些常见问题

    MySQL的常见问题包括: 性能问题:MySQL在处理大量数据时可能会出现性能问题,例如慢查询、索引失效等。 死锁问题:当多个事务同时访问数据库时,可能会出现死锁...

  • Log4net与MySQL的集成教程有哪些

    Log4net与MySQL的集成教程如下: 配置log4net.config文件:
    在log4net.config文件中配置一个MySQL的Appender,示例如下: 配置log4net初始化:
    在应用...

  • 如何优化Log4net与MySQL的性能

    要优化Log4net与MySQL的性能,可以采取以下措施: 配置Log4net:通过调整Log4net的配置文件,可以优化日志记录的方式和级别,以减少对系统性能的影响。可以考虑使...

  • Log4net连接MySQL时可能遇到哪些问题

    配置文件错误:在log4net的配置文件中,可能会出现错误的数据库连接字符串或者其他配置项,导致无法连接到MySQL数据库。 权限问题:MySQL数据库可能设置了访问权...

  • nanosleep在Linux多线程编程中的作用

    nanosleep函数在Linux多线程编程中的作用是让当前线程挂起一段时间,以实现线程的延迟执行或定时任务。通过调用nanosleep函数,可以让当前线程在指定的时间内进行...